Abstract: A process for the production of oligomerized olefins comprising the following steps: purification of an organic composition (OCI) in at least one adsorber to obtain an organic composition (OC2); oligomerization of organic composition (OC2) in the presence of a catalyst to obtain an organic composition (OC3); distillation of organic composition (OC3) in a distillation column (DI) to obtain an organic composition (OC4) from the upper part of (DI) and an organic composition (OC5) from the lower part of (DI); hydrogenation of organic composition (OC4) to obtain an organic composition (OCI 1) and regeneration of an adsorber (Al) employing organic composition (OC11) as regeneration media.

Abstract: The invention relates to a process for the regeneration of an adsorber. For the regeneration a liquid stream (S2) comprising at least one alkane is converted from liquid phase into gaseous phase. Then the adsorber is regenerated and heated by contact with gaseous stream (S2) up to 230 to 270? C. Subsequently, the adsorber is cooled first by contact with gaseous stream (S2) to a temperature of 90 to 150? C. followed by cooling with liquid stream (S2) to a temperature below 80? C. The outflow of the adsorber (S2*) during the cooling with gaseous stream (S2) and optionally the outflow of the adsorber (S2*) during cooling with liquid stream (S2) is recycled in at least one of these steps.
